The University is seeking to procure advice, guidance and support for students and graduates that are either considering the idea of self-employment or business start-up as a chosen career path, or who are looking to develop enterprising skills and entrepreneurial mindset to enhance their employability. Support will be delivered using a mixed methods approach, through dedicated one-to-one mentoring sessions, workshops, in-residency days at our on-campus Incubator, as well as through bootcamp style events.
